The mean values and the number of observations in each cell of a 2 x 2 classification table are Means Column 1 Column 2 Observations Column 1 Column 2 Row 1 87 51 Row 1 13 14 Row 2 37 29 Row 2 16 17 Illustration: The cell in row 1 column 1 has a mean of 87 from a sample of 13 observations. An actuary is setting class relativities for insurance pricing using an additive model and the balance principle. The mean value of the cell with row (j) and column (k)= base rate + row relativity (j) + column relativity (k). The base rate is 10, and the initial column relativities are 10 for Column 1 and 0 for Column 2. Question 1.39: Balance principle additive model implied relativity What is the implied relativity for Row 1, using the initial relativities by column? A. 45.491 B. 48.167 C. 50.843 D. 53.519 E. 56.194 Question 1.40: Balance principle additive model implied relativity What is the implied relativity for Column 2, using the computed relativities by row?
